Result of Poll – Chichester City Councillor South Ward

You can also download a PDF copy of this notice here: Declaration of Result

Chichester District Council Election of a City Councillor for Chichester South Ward on Thursday 12 June 2025

Name of CandidateDescription (if any)Number of Votes
BROME THOMPSON, Geoffrey JamesLabour Party149
DISCOMBE, TracyIndependent54
EMERSON, AndrewPatria39
RUSSELL, Nicholas JohnLiberal Democrats605
SHOPLAND, Joseph DavidIndependent142
Vacant Seats: 1Electorate: 5195Turnout: 19.29 %       

Nicholas John Russell is duly elected.
